Consider the following. (Give your answers correct to two decimal places.)
(a) Find the standard score (z) such that the area above the mean and below z under the normal curve is 0.3828.
(b) Find the standard score (z) such that the area above the mean and below z under the normal curve is 0.4714.
(c) Find the standard score (z) such that the area above the mean and below z under the normal curve is 0.3712.
